Micro fiber optic fusion splicer

Micro fiber optic fusion splicers are precision devices that join optical fibers end-to-end using thermal fusion, offering low-loss, high-reliability connections for single fibers or micro-scale fibers.

Overview

A micro fiber optic fusion splicer is a specialized tool designed to fuse very small-diameter optical fibers, including single-mode, multimode, and specialty fibers such as photonic crystal fibers or double-clad fibers. The splicing process uses an electric arc to melt the fiber ends, creating a seamless joint with minimal signal loss and reflection, which is critical for high-speed, long-distance data transmission in telecom, FTTH, and data center applications .

Key Features

  • Precision Core Alignment: Ensures the fiber cores are perfectly aligned before fusion, which is essential for micro fibers with very small cores .
  • Automated Splicing: Modern splicers often include automated calibration, arc adjustment, and smart features like cloud syncing for data logging .
  • Portability: Many micro splicers are compact and lightweight, suitable for fieldwork or laboratory use .
  • Compatibility: Can handle single fibers, fiber ribbons, and specialty fibers, including high-power fiber lasers and photonic crystal fibers .
  • Durability: Designed for repeated use with minimal maintenance, often including replaceable electrodes and cleaver blades .

Manufacturers and Models

Leading manufacturers of micro fiber optic fusion splicers include Fujikura, INNO, Sumitomo, FITEL, and 3SAE Technologies. Notable models for precision splicing include the Fujikura 90S+, INNO View 8+, and Sumitomo Type-72C+, each offering different features for field or lab environments . 3SAE Technologies also provides advanced splicers for specialty fibers, including photonic crystal and high-power fibers, with innovations like the Ring of Fire® plasma technology for improved fiber preparation and splicing .

Considerations for Use

  • Fiber Cleaving: A high-quality cleave is essential for a strong, low-loss splice .
  • Training: Proper training ensures optimal use of automated features and maintenance procedures .
  • Maintenance: Regular electrode replacement, blade cleaning, and calibration are necessary for consistent performance .
  • Project Requirements: Selection depends on fiber type, project scale, portability needs, and budget . Micro fiber optic fusion splicers are indispensable tools for modern fiber optic networks, providing precision, reliability, and efficiency in both field and laboratory environments .
